The MC68332, a highly-integrated 32-bit microcontroller, combines high-performance data manipula tion capabilities with powerful peripheral subsystems. The MCU is built up from standard modules that interface through a common intermodule bus (IMB). Standardization facilitates rapid development of devices tailored for specific applications.
●Features
●• Central Processing Unit (CPU32)
●— 32-Bit Architecture
●— Virtual Memory Implementation
●— Table Lookup and Interpolate Instruction
●— Improved Exception Handling for Controller Applications
●— High-Level Language Support
●— Background Debugging Mode
●— Fully Static Operation
●• System Integration Module (SIM)
●— External Bus Support
●— Programmable Chip-Select Outputs
●— System Protection Logic
●— Watchdog Timer, Clock Monitor, and Bus Monitor
●— Two 8-Bit Dual Function Input/Output Ports
●— One 7-Bit Dual Function Output Port
●— Phase-Locked Loop (PLL) Clock System
●• Time Processor Unit (TPU)
●— Dedicated Microengine Operating Independently of CPU32
●— 16 Independent, Programmable Channels and Pins
●— Any Channel can Perform any Time Function
●— Two Timer Count Registers with Programmable Prescalers
●— Selectable Channel Priority Levels
●• Queued Serial Module (QSM)
●— Enhanced Serial Communication Interface
●— Queued Serial Peripheral Interface
●— One 8-Bit Dual Function Port
●• Static RAM Module with TPU Emulation Capability (TPURAM)
●— 2-Kbytes of Static RAM
●— May be Used as Normal RAM or TPU Microcode Emulation RAM